The Rise of Electric SUVs
SUVs remain incredibly popular, so it's no surprise that many manufacturers are developing electric SUVs for 2025. These vehicles combine the practicality and spaciousness of an SUV with the environmental benefits of an electric powertrain. Automakers like Ford, GM, and Volkswagen are all set to introduce new electric SUVs that promise impressive performance and versatility.
Ford, for instance, is expected to expand its Mustang Mach-E lineup with new trims and features, potentially including a higher-performance variant. GM is likely to introduce electric versions of its popular SUV models, such as the Cadillac Escalade, providing a luxurious and eco-friendly option for buyers. Volkswagen, with its ID. series, will likely add a new electric SUV that builds on the success of the ID.4.
These electric SUVs will not only offer zero-emission driving but also advanced technology features, such as over-the-air software updates, adv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), and large touchscreen displays. Expect premium materials and comfortable interiors, making these SUVs ideal for families and those who need extra cargo space.

Eco-Friendly ICE Innovations
Even with the rise of EVs, automakers are focused on making their ICE vehicles more eco-friendly. This includes developing more efficient engines, reducing emissions, and using sustainable materials in vehicle construction. In 2025, expect to see new ICE models that incorporate these eco-friendly innovations.
For example, automakers are exploring new types of fuels, such as biofuels and synthetic fuels, that can reduce the carbon footprint of ICE vehicles. They are also implementing advanced exhaust treatment systems that minimize emissions of harmful pollutants.
Furthermore, automakers are using more recycled and sustainable materials in vehicle interiors and exteriors, reducing the environmental impact of vehicle production. These efforts demonstrate a commitment to sustainability, even in the realm of ICE vehicles.

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S)
ADAS features are becoming increasingly sophisticated, helping drivers stay safe on the road. In 2025, expect to see more advanced ADAS systems that offer features such as ad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, automatic emergency braking, and blind-spot monitoring.
These systems use a combination of sensors, cameras, and radar to monitor the vehicle's surroundings and provide warnings or interventions when necessary. Some ADAS systems are even capable of partially automating driving tasks, such as highway driving.
As ADAS technology continues to evolve, it has the potential to significantly reduce accidents and improve overall road safety. Automakers are committed to making these systems more accessible and affordable for all drivers.
Seamless Connectivity
Connectivity is becoming an integral part of the driving experience. In 2025, expect to see more vehicles with seamless connectivity features, such as over-the-air software updates, smartphone integration, and cloud-based services.
Over-the-air software updates allow automakers to remotely update vehicle software, adding new features and improving performance. Smartphone integration allows drivers to seamlessly access their favorite apps and services from the vehicle's infotainment system.
Cloud-based services provide access to a variety of information and entertainment options, such as real-time traffic updates, streaming music, and voice-activated assistants.
